SEO vs. SEM: Understanding the Key Differences and Benefits

In the dynamic world of digital marketing, two essential strategies often get conflated: Search Engine Optimization and Search Engine Marketing. While both aim to drive traffic to your website, they operate through distinct mechanisms and offer unique benefits. Grasping the key differences between SEO and SEM is crucial for crafting a successful online presence.

SEO encompasses the strategies of optimizing your website content and technical structure to rank higher in organic search results. This involves keyword research, on-page optimization, link building, and creating valuable, engaging material that resonates with your target audience. On the other hand, SEM involves purchasing advertisements to display at the top of search engine results pages (SERPs). This allows businesses to reach a wider audience instantly, but requires ongoing investment.

  • Organic Search's primary advantage lies in its long-term sustainability.
  • In contrast, offers fast results and precise targeting options.

Ultimately, the best approach often involves a blended strategy that combines both SEO and SEM. This allows businesses to leverage the long-term benefits of organic search while benefiting from the immediate visibility of paid advertising.

This Ultimate Showdown: SEO vs SEM in Digital Marketing

In the ever-evolving realm of digital marketing, two titans battle for supremacy: Search Engine Optimization (SEO) and Search Engine Marketing (SEM). While both aim to increase online visibility, their approaches differ dramatically. SEO, the practice of optimizing websites to rank organically in search results, is a strategic game that requires patience and meticulousness. SEM, on the other hand, involves purchasing keywords to display paid advertisements at the top of search results. This rapid approach provides immediate exposure but demands a continuous investment.

SEO's efficacy lies in its ability to attract organic traffic, building authority over time. SEM, however, offers the flexibility to target specific keywords and audiences with laser-like accuracy. Ultimately, the best method depends on your objectives, budget, and framework. Some businesses may profit from a integrated approach, leveraging both SEO's lasting value and SEM's immediate impact.
